Abstract
We have measured the additional resistivity produced in a GaAs/AlGaAs heterostructure by magnetising an array of magnetic squares deposited on the surface. Semi-classical transport simulations explain qualitatively the main features of our data, whereas the hypothesis of electron–electron umklapp scattering fails to account for several important features.
